[docs]def htpx(T=None, P=None, x=None): """ Convenience function to calculate steam enthalpy from temperature and either pressure or vapor fraction. This function can be used for inlet streams and initialization where temperature is known instead of enthalpy. User must provide values for two of T, P, or x. Args: T: Temperature with units (between 200 and 3000 K) P: Pressure with units (between 1 and 1e9 Pa), None if saturated vapor x: Vapor fraction [mol vapor/mol total] (between 0 and 1), None if superheated or subcooled Returns: Total molar enthalpy [J/mol]. """ prop = HelmholtzParameterBlock(pure_component="H2O") prop.construct() return prop.htpx(T=T, p=P, x=x)
